Lot 1169 Bemerkungen auf einer Reise …

Bemerkungen auf einer Reise von Kopenhagen nach Wien im Jahr 1793. Hamburg, B. G. Hoffmann, 1795. Ss. I-IV (Titelbl., Vorw.) u. Ss. 5-184. Kl.-8°. Pbd. d. Zt., bezogen mit Kiebitzpapier und goldgepr. RTit. auf Papierschild (etw. bestoßen und berieben).

Europa

Geographie und Reisen – Erste und einzige Ausgabe des privaten Reiseberichts. - Nicht in VD18. - Enthält 10 meist unterhaltsame Briefe mit Reiseeindrücken u.a. aus Hamburg, Berlin, Dresden, Prag u.v.a. Wien. - Emanuel Bozenhard (1744-99) war Diplomat in Habsburgischen Diensten und fungierte u.a. als Österr. Generalkonsul in Dänemark. - Wohl in kleiner Auflage erschienen, wie auch das Vorwort des Autors vermuten lässt: "Nach meine Zurückkunft von Wien, ließ ich, dem Wunsch einiger Freunde zufolge, mein Tagebuch drucken und theilte diese wenige Exemplare unter denselben aus." (S. III) - Provenienz: Grosherzogliche Bibliothek Neustrelitz, mit dem Stempel der 1917 aufgelösten Institution auf Titelbl. verso. - Vorderer fliegender Vorsatz recto mit älterem biographischem Eintrag zum Autor, Papier etwas gebräunt, sonst wohlerhalten.

Geography and Travel – First and only edition of private travel accounts by an Austrian diplomat. - Contains 10 mostly entertaining letters with travel impressions from Hamburg, Berlin, Dresden, Prague and moreover Vienna. - Emanuel Bozenhard (1744-99) was a diplomat in the service of the Habsburgs and served as Austrian Consul General in Denmark, among other positions. - Probably published in a small print run, as the author's preface suggests: 'After my return from Vienna, I had my diary printed at the request of some friends and distributed these few copies among them.' (p. III) - Provenance: Grosherzogliche Bibliothek Neustrelitz, with the stamp of this institution, which was dissolved in 1917, on the verso of the title page. - Front flyleaf recto with older biographical entry about the author, paper slightly browned, otherwise well preserved.
